NAPERVILLE, IL — Naperville Planning and Zoning Commission members recently discussed a proposal to build 32 townhomes at 2255 Monarch Dr., according to Chicago Tribune.
M/I Homes, petitioners for the development, called NorthGate of Naperville, are proposing to build the townhomes on the vacant 25-acre lot on the I-88 corridor.
During the June 17 Planning and Zoning Commission meeting, staff member Anna Franco mentioned that the project does not align with the city's master plan, which designates the site as a regional center. Franco later raised concerns about the affordability of the proposed townhomes.
Other city staff and planning commission members expressed that the proposed NorthGate of Naperville townhomes would improve the area.
